
The director, publicity and advocacy, Northern Elders Forum, NEF, Hakeem Baba-Ahmed, has said the immediate past president, Muhammadu Buhari, lowered the bar of governance in the country.
He said the “woeful performance” of the former president will never be matched by any president.
Mr Baba-Ahmed stated this in an interview with Vanguard Newspaper on Saturday.
The elder statesman also advised President Bola Tinubu not to overburden the citizens with his policies, noting that Nigerians are already stretched.
“Eight years ago when President Buhari came, he cleared all checkpoints, removed Service Chiefs, and ordered the military to relocate to Borno, then Boko Haram was chased and limited substantially. These were greeted by the same euphoria. There was enthusiasm that he would fight corruption, insecurity, and a bad economy.
“But look at where we are now after eight years. We are worse than when he came in. Certainly, the entire country had not been in the situation before. So, forgive me if the Northern Elders Forum has a different perspective on the euphoria as a result of the tentative action or salvo being released by President Tinubu against the economy, corruption and service chiefs, and others. I will rather exercise some reservations.
“It is good he is starting with some policies, but he has to be very careful, he should not rush into putting in policies just because he wants to be different from Buhari. By all means, any worse government will be better than Buhari’s government of misrule, indifference, and incompetence.
“I am sorry if I don’t share your enthusiasm [about Tinubu]. I will rather advise him to be different from Buhari, and address those issues that need to be addressed with courage and sensitivity. Buhari has lowered the bar of governance and lowered our status of existence; insecurity and poverty are more pronounced,” Mr Baba-Ahmed added.
